'Save Manipur, Save Humanity' campaign held
Source: The Sangai Express
Bishnupur, March 31 2024:
A one-day programme on the theme 'Save Manipur, Save Humanity' was organised by Bishnupur District Council, Communist Party of India (CPI) today at Open Bhawan, CPI District Office, Bishnupur.
Today's programme was attended by party leaders from six Assembly Constituencies of Bishnupur district, said a press release by the Office Secretary, Manipur State Council, CPI.
Comrade Kh Kulachandra, CPI State Secretary Comrade L Thoiren; Assistant Secretaries Comrade M Joykumar Luwang; Comrade N Singhajit and All Manipur Nupi Marup President Comrade M Sakhi Devi graced as the presidium members of the event.
Speaking at the occasion, L Thoiren called for support and cooperation from the masses in the campaign conducted by CPI on the theme 'Save Manipur, Save Humanity', which is being held in different districts across the State.
He stressed on the need of making concerted efforts to safeguard the unity and integrity of Manipur.
He also spoke about measures for strengthening the activities of CPI.
In view of the prevailing conflict situation, Thoiren urged the Government to expedite steps to restore peace and normalcy in the State and ramp up measures for resettlement of displaced people at their respective native lands who are currently taking shelter at relief camps and pre-fabricated houses.
In today's programme, discussions were held on the developmental activities and resolutions were also passed which include urging the Government authorities concerned to take stock of the developmental requirements in Bishnupur District Headquarters and take up relevant welfare measures accordingly.
CPI Bishnupur District Council also demanded that there should be regular supply of water in Loktak lift irrigation canals throughout the year for the well being of the farmers of the district.
The party further demanded that the Tiddim Road in the district should be upgraded to a four-lane highway, said the release.
